Electrelane, ‚”No Shouts, No Calls”
Beggars Banquet 2007

Fans of Stereolab bummed out about the band’s last few not-so-great records now have reason to rejoice: Electrelane have come along to pick up the slack. They share many of the same elements as the ‘lab: breathy, Euro-girl vocals, pulsating keyboards, and lots of random beeps and squeaks, and manage to mix their songs in a way that perfectly balances all the musical elements, never burying the vocals or throwing on extraneous distortion. Unlike the ‘lab, whose recent experiments have descended in to dull drones, Electrelane keep listeners engaged and don’t lose them in a haze of noise. While the whole album is solid, standout tracks include opener ‚”The Greater Times,” where lead singer Verity Susman shows off her vocal prowess; the spacey ‚”Tram 21,” and the hypnotic, bass-driven ‚”To The East.”
